President's Award for Teachers

The President’s Award for Teachers (PAT) recognises excellent educators for their role in moulding the future of our nation. RP celebrates the hard work and dedication of our educators in inspiring our students and their peers.

2025 Finalist


"Every student matters to me, each with unique needs and aspirations. They’re my inspiration—they push me to rethink how I teach and how I connect with industry."

– Eric Kwek, Senior Lecturer at RP School of Applied Science and Finalist for the President's Award for Teachers 2025

Mr Eric Kwek

Born with an eyesight anomaly, Eric understands the transformative power of teachers who believe in their students' potential. Over his 20-year career, he has helped students like Crystal Tan overcome self-doubt to become valedictorian and pursue Life Sciences at NUS, and Joanne Chew develop teamwork skills to secure a role at the Singapore Food Agency. When students found his module difficult to relate to, Eric redesigned it using storytelling and real-world practices, earning him the MOE Innergy (Commendation) Award in 2023 and equipping over 130 students with professional Food Safety credentials.

Eric's impact extends beyond the classroom through industry partnerships with Wilmar International and Enterprise Singapore, creating Singapore's first internship Playbook for Food Manufacturers. His commitment to continuous learning—earning ISO 22000 certification in 2024 and training in Germany—has inspired colleagues to strengthen their expertise. Congratulations to Eric for embodying RP's ExCITE values and creating greater possibilities for students and the food industry.
